[Bug 1635844] Re: /etc/logrotate.d/ceph and /etc/logrotate.d/ceph-base both manage /var/log/ceph/ which causes "error: ceph-base:1 duplicate log entry for /var/log/ceph/ceph-mon.[hostname].log" during hourly logrotate

James Page james.page at ubuntu.com
Wed Jan 18 09:26:17 UTC 2017


** Description changed:

- /etc/logrotate.d/ceph and /etc/logrotate.d/ceph-base both manage
- /var/log/ceph/ which causes "error: ceph-base:1 duplicate log entry for
- /var/log/ceph/ceph-mon.[hostname].log" during hourly logrotate
+ [Impact]
+ Multiple log rotate configs attempt to manage the same set of log files
+ 
+ [Test Case]
+ apt install ceph-mon ceph-osd
+ <error message below will be seen>
+ 
+ [Regression Potential]
+ Minimal - logrotate configuration will be correctly removed on upgrades from the ceph package (although its now in the ceph-common, not ceph-base package with the proposed update to cover radosgw as well)
+ 
+ [Original Bug Report]
+ /etc/logrotate.d/ceph and /etc/logrotate.d/ceph-base both manage /var/log/ceph/ which causes "error: ceph-base:1 duplicate log entry for /var/log/ceph/ceph-mon.[hostname].log" during hourly logrotate
  
  ProblemType: Bug
  DistroRelease: Ubuntu 16.10
  Package: ceph 10.2.3-0ubuntu2
  Uname: Linux 4.8.0-040800-generic x86_64
  NonfreeKernelModules: openafs
  ApportVersion: 2.20.3-0ubuntu8
  Architecture: amd64
  Date: Sat Oct 22 16:32:23 2016
  InstallationDate: Installed on 2015-04-20 (550 days ago)
  InstallationMedia: Ubuntu-Server 14.10 "Utopic Unicorn" - Release amd64 (20141022.2)
  ProcEnviron:
-  TERM=screen.xterm-256color
-  PATH=(custom, no user)
-  XDG_RUNTIME_DIR=<set>
-  LANG=de_DE.UTF-8
-  SHELL=/bin/bash
+  TERM=screen.xterm-256color
+  PATH=(custom, no user)
+  XDG_RUNTIME_DIR=<set>
+  LANG=de_DE.UTF-8
+  SHELL=/bin/bash
  SourcePackage: ceph
  UpgradeStatus: Upgraded to yakkety on 2016-10-19 (2 days ago)

** Description changed:

  [Impact]
  Multiple log rotate configs attempt to manage the same set of log files
  
  [Test Case]
- apt install ceph-mon ceph-osd
+ apt install ceph-mon ceph-osd (xenial)
+ upgrade to yakkety
  <error message below will be seen>
  
  [Regression Potential]
  Minimal - logrotate configuration will be correctly removed on upgrades from the ceph package (although its now in the ceph-common, not ceph-base package with the proposed update to cover radosgw as well)
  
  [Original Bug Report]
  /etc/logrotate.d/ceph and /etc/logrotate.d/ceph-base both manage /var/log/ceph/ which causes "error: ceph-base:1 duplicate log entry for /var/log/ceph/ceph-mon.[hostname].log" during hourly logrotate
  
  ProblemType: Bug
  DistroRelease: Ubuntu 16.10
  Package: ceph 10.2.3-0ubuntu2
  Uname: Linux 4.8.0-040800-generic x86_64
  NonfreeKernelModules: openafs
  ApportVersion: 2.20.3-0ubuntu8
  Architecture: amd64
  Date: Sat Oct 22 16:32:23 2016
  InstallationDate: Installed on 2015-04-20 (550 days ago)
  InstallationMedia: Ubuntu-Server 14.10 "Utopic Unicorn" - Release amd64 (20141022.2)
  ProcEnviron:
   TERM=screen.xterm-256color
   PATH=(custom, no user)
   XDG_RUNTIME_DIR=<set>
   LANG=de_DE.UTF-8
   SHELL=/bin/bash
  SourcePackage: ceph
  UpgradeStatus: Upgraded to yakkety on 2016-10-19 (2 days ago)

** Also affects: ceph (Ubuntu Yakkety)
   Importance: Undecided
       Status: New

** Changed in: ceph (Ubuntu Yakkety)
       Status: New => Triaged

** Changed in: ceph (Ubuntu Yakkety)
   Importance: Undecided => Medium

-- 
You received this bug notification because you are a member of Ubuntu
OpenStack, which is subscribed to ceph in Ubuntu.
https://bugs.launchpad.net/bugs/1635844

Title:
  /etc/logrotate.d/ceph and /etc/logrotate.d/ceph-base both manage
  /var/log/ceph/ which causes "error: ceph-base:1 duplicate log entry
  for /var/log/ceph/ceph-mon.[hostname].log" during hourly logrotate

Status in ceph package in Ubuntu:
  Fix Released
Status in ceph source package in Yakkety:
  Triaged

Bug description:
  [Impact]
  Multiple log rotate configs attempt to manage the same set of log files

  [Test Case]
  apt install ceph-mon ceph-osd (xenial)
  upgrade to yakkety
  <error message below will be seen>

  [Regression Potential]
  Minimal - logrotate configuration will be correctly removed on upgrades from the ceph package (although its now in the ceph-common, not ceph-base package with the proposed update to cover radosgw as well)

  [Original Bug Report]
  /etc/logrotate.d/ceph and /etc/logrotate.d/ceph-base both manage /var/log/ceph/ which causes "error: ceph-base:1 duplicate log entry for /var/log/ceph/ceph-mon.[hostname].log" during hourly logrotate

  ProblemType: Bug
  DistroRelease: Ubuntu 16.10
  Package: ceph 10.2.3-0ubuntu2
  Uname: Linux 4.8.0-040800-generic x86_64
  NonfreeKernelModules: openafs
  ApportVersion: 2.20.3-0ubuntu8
  Architecture: amd64
  Date: Sat Oct 22 16:32:23 2016
  InstallationDate: Installed on 2015-04-20 (550 days ago)
  InstallationMedia: Ubuntu-Server 14.10 "Utopic Unicorn" - Release amd64 (20141022.2)
  ProcEnviron:
   TERM=screen.xterm-256color
   PATH=(custom, no user)
   XDG_RUNTIME_DIR=<set>
   LANG=de_DE.UTF-8
   SHELL=/bin/bash
  SourcePackage: ceph
  UpgradeStatus: Upgraded to yakkety on 2016-10-19 (2 days ago)

To manage notifications about this bug go to:
https://bugs.launchpad.net/ubuntu/+source/ceph/+bug/1635844/+subscriptions



More information about the Ubuntu-openstack-bugs mailing list